Class FindReplaceOptions

Class FindReplaceOptions

名称: Aspose.Words.Replacing 合計: Aspose.Words.dll (25.4.0)

オペレーションを検索/置き換えるオプションを指定します。

もっと知るには、訪問してください。 Find and Replace 文書記事です。

public class FindReplaceOptions

Inheritance

object FindReplaceOptions

相続人

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

FindReplaceOptions()

FindReplaceOptions クラスの新しいインスタンスをデフォルト設定で開始します。

public FindReplaceOptions()

FindReplaceOptions(FindReplaceDirection)

FindReplaceOptions クラスの新しいインスタンスを指定された方向で開始します。

public FindReplaceOptions(FindReplaceDirection direction)

Parameters

direction FindReplaceDirection

発見と置き換え作業の方向。

FindReplaceOptions(IREPLACINGCALLBACK)

FindReplaceOptions クラスの新しいインスタンスを指定された置き換えの呼び返しで開始します。

public FindReplaceOptions(IReplacingCallback replacingCallback)

Parameters

replacingCallback IReplacingCallback

見つけたテキストを置き換えるために使用するコールバック。

FindReplaceOptions(タイトル:IREPLACINGCALLBACK)

FindReplaceOptions クラスの新しいインスタンスを指定された方向で開始し、呼び戻しを置き換える。

public FindReplaceOptions(FindReplaceDirection direction, IReplacingCallback replacingCallback)

Parameters

direction FindReplaceDirection

発見と置き換え作業の方向。

replacingCallback IReplacingCallback

見つけたテキストを置き換えるために使用するコールバック。

Properties

ApplyFont

新しいコンテンツに適用されたテキストフォーマット

public Font ApplyFont { get; }

不動産価値

Font

ApplyParagraphFormat

新しいコンテンツに適用された段落の形式化。

public ParagraphFormat ApplyParagraphFormat { get; }

不動産価値

ParagraphFormat

Direction

デフォルト値は Aspose.Words.Replacing.FindReplaceDirection.Forward です。

public FindReplaceDirection Direction { get; set; }

不動産価値

FindReplaceDirection

FindWholeWordsOnly

真実は、古い価値は単一の単語でなければならないことを示しています。

public bool FindWholeWordsOnly { get; set; }

不動産価値

bool

IgnoreDeleted

受信または表示するボーラー値は、削除レビュー内のテキストを無視することを示す。

public bool IgnoreDeleted { get; set; }

不動産価値

bool

IgnoreFieldCodes

フィールドコード内のテキストを無視することを示すボーリー値を取得または設定します.デフォルト値は「偽物」です。

public bool IgnoreFieldCodes { get; set; }

不動産価値

bool

Remarks

このオプションはフィールドコードにのみ影響します(Aspose.Words.NodeType.FieldSeparator とAspose.Words.NodeType.FieldEnd の間のノードを無視することはありません)。

全フィールドを無視するには、適切なオプション Aspose.Words.Replacing.FindReplaceOptions.IgnoreFields を使用してください。

IgnoreFields

フィールド内のテキストを無視することを示すボーリー値を取得または設定します.デフォルト値は「偽物」です。

public bool IgnoreFields { get; set; }

不動産価値

bool

Remarks

このオプションは、全フィールド(Aspose.Words.NodeType.FieldStart とAspose.Words.NodeType.FieldEnd の間のすべてのノード)に影響を与えます。

フィールドコードのみを無視するには、適切なオプション Aspose.Words.Replacing.FindReplaceOptions.IgnoreFieldCodes を使用してください。

IgnoreFootnotes

ノートを無視することを示すボーレー値を取得または設定します.デフォルト値は「偽物」です。

public bool IgnoreFootnotes { get; set; }

不動産価値

bool

IgnoreInserted

入力レビュー内のテキストを無視することを示すボーレー値を取得または設定します.デフォルト値は「偽」です。

public bool IgnoreInserted { get; set; }

不動産価値

bool

IgnoreShapes

テキスト内の形状を無視することを示すボーレー値を取得または設定します。

デフォルト値です。

public bool IgnoreShapes { get; set; }

不動産価値

bool

IgnoreStructuredDocumentTags

Aspose.Words.Markup.StructuredDocumentTag のコンテンツを無視することを示すボーレー値を取得または設定します。

public bool IgnoreStructuredDocumentTags { get; set; }

不動産価値

bool

Remarks

このオプションが設定された場合、 Aspose.Words.Markup.StructuredDocumentTag のコンテンツは単純なテキストとして扱われます。

いずれにせよ、 Aspose.Words.Markup.StructuredDocumentTag は単独ストーリーとして処理され、置き換えパターンはそれぞれに個別に検索されます _ www.marking.structured Dokument Tag, したがって、パタンが _wl26.Marking。

LegacyMode

古い発見/置き換えアルゴリズムが使用されていることを示すボーレー値を取得または設定します。

public bool LegacyMode { get; set; }

不動産価値

bool

Remarks

このフラッグを使用すると、先進的な検索/置き換え機能が導入される前と同じ行動が必要になります。古いアルゴリズムは、ブレイクを置き換え、フォーマットを適用するなど、高度な機能をサポートしていないことに注意してください。

MatchCase

真実はケース感性比較を示し、偽りはケース感性比較を示す。

public bool MatchCase { get; set; }

不動産価値

bool

ReplacementFormat

デフォルトは Aspose.Words.Replacing.ReplacementFormat.Text です。

public ReplacementFormat ReplacementFormat { get; set; }

不動産価値

ReplacementFormat

Remarks

Aspose.Words.LowCode.Replacer で使用する場合のみ有効です。

ReplacingCallback

ユーザーによって定義された方法は、それぞれの代替が発生する前に呼ばれます。

public IReplacingCallback ReplacingCallback { get; set; }

不動産価値

IReplacingCallback

SmartParagraphBreakReplacement

受けるか、または次の兄弟段落がない場合に段落の割り当てを置き換えることが許可されているかを示すボーレー値を設定します。

デフォルト値です。

public bool SmartParagraphBreakReplacement { get; set; }

不動産価値

bool

Remarks

このオプションでは、次の兄弟の段落がない場合に段落の割り当てを置き換えることができます。ノードは、段落が置き換えられた後、次の段落(必ずしも兄弟ではない)を見つけることによって移動することができます。

UseLegacyOrder

真実は、テキスト検索がテキストボックスを考慮して上から下に順序的に行われることを示しています。デフォルト値は「偽物」です。

public bool UseLegacyOrder { get; set; }

不動産価値

bool

UseSubstitutions

代替パターン内で代替品を認識し、使用するかどうかを示すボーレー値を取得または設定します。

public bool UseSubstitutions { get; set; }

不動産価値

bool

Remarks

代替要素の詳細については、以下を参照してください。https://docs.microsoft.com/en-us/dotnet/standard/base-types/substitutions-in-regular-expressions。

 日本語